Wineries: From Napa to Sonoma – A Grape Escape

Let’s kick things off with the liquid gold that put California on the map for many: wine! Napa Valley and Sonoma – these aren’t just names on a bottle, people. They’re legendary wine regions with a history as rich and complex as a perfectly aged Cabernet Sauvignon.

Napa Valley is synonymous with luxury and world-class wines. Its meticulously cared-for vineyards produce some of the most sought-after Cabernet Sauvignons, Chardonnays, and Merlots in the world. Think rolling hills, stunning estates, and unforgettable tasting experiences. Sonoma, just a hop, skip, and a jump away, offers a more laid-back vibe with a wider range of microclimates allowing for diverse wine styles. From the cool-climate Pinot Noirs of the Russian River Valley to the Zinfandels of Dry Creek Valley, Sonoma is a treasure trove for wine lovers seeking discovery.

What makes California wine so special? It’s a combination of factors: the Mediterranean climate with warm, sunny days and cool nights, the diverse soil types that impart unique flavors to the grapes, and the passionate winemakers who are constantly pushing the boundaries of innovation. Whether it’s the bold, structured wines of Stag’s Leap Wine Cellars in Napa or the elegant Pinot Noirs of Williams Selyem in Sonoma, California winemaking is a testament to the state’s commitment to quality and terroir.

Silicon Valley: The Epicenter of Tech

Picture this: a sunny stretch of land south of San Francisco, where dreams are coded into reality. That’s Silicon Valley, folks! It wasn’t always the tech mecca. Its roots are surprisingly humble, stretching back to the mid-20th century with the rise of Stanford University and its close ties to electronics companies. But then the transistor happened, followed by the integrated circuit, and BAM! A revolution was born.

Now, it’s home to giants like Apple, Google, Facebook (or Meta, whatever), and countless startups, all vying for the next big breakthrough. Silicon Valley is more than just a geographical location; it’s a mindset, a culture of relentless innovation, risk-taking, and, let’s be honest, a whole lot of caffeine. It’s where billion-dollar ideas are hatched in garages (or, more likely, sleek, modern offices with kombucha on tap). It’s the undisputed epicenter of the tech universe.

Government Support: Agencies Promoting California Businesses

Okay, let’s talk about the behind-the-scenes heroes – the California state government agencies that are basically business besties. They’re all about helping California companies thrive and making the Golden State’s economy shine brighter than a Hollywood smile. Think of them as the ultimate hype squad for California-made goods!

First up, we have the Governor’s Office of Business and Economic Development (GO-Biz). This is the place to start. They are like the concierge of the California business world. Need help navigating regulations, finding funding, or expanding your operations? GO-Biz is there to connect you with the right resources. They’re practically business matchmakers, pairing companies with the support they need to succeed.

Then there’s the California Small Business Development Center (SBDC) Network. These guys are like having a team of experienced business consultants in your corner, without the crazy consultant fees. They offer free advising, workshops, and resources to help small businesses start, grow, and prosper. Whether you need help with marketing, finance, or operations, the SBDC is there to guide you every step of the way.

And let’s not forget the California Manufacturing Technology Consulting (CMTC). If you’re in the manufacturing game, these are your peeps. CMTC provides consulting and training services to help manufacturers improve their competitiveness, adopt new technologies, and drive innovation. They’re like the pit crew for California’s manufacturing sector, helping companies fine-tune their operations and stay ahead of the curve.
